Leading ACC Schools Ranked by Undergraduate Student Focus


Choosing the right university often depends on the campus atmosphere, and for many, the balance between undergraduate and graduate populations is a key factor. In the Atlantic Coast Conference (ACC), institutions vary significantly in how they distribute their resources between student levels. This list ranks conference members based on the percentage of undergraduate students relative to total enrollment, helping you identify campuses where the "college experience" is at the forefront of the university mission.

Schools with high undergraduate concentrations often foster a vibrant community focused on the foundational years of higher education. In these environments, campus life, faculty attention, and extracurricular programming are frequently tailored to meet the needs of those pursuing their first degrees. This creates a high-energy academic setting where the undergraduate population defines the cultural identity of the campus.

Conversely, institutions within the conference that maintain a higher ratio of graduate and professional students often offer a more research-intensive dynamic.
